Biography of Nikki Minaj

Nikki Minaj, born Onika Tanya Maraj on December 8, 1982, in Saint James, Trinidad and Tobago, is a rapper, singer, and songwriter known for her dynamic style and versatility. She moved to the United States at a young age and grew up in Queens, New York. Nikki’s early influences included artists like Lil' Kim and Foxy Brown, who inspired her to pursue a career in music.

Music Career Highlights

Nikki Minaj's music career took off in the late 2000s with the release of her mixtapes, which showcased her lyrical prowess and unique style. Her debut album, "Pink Friday," released in 2010, was a commercial success and solidified her place in the music industry. Here are some of her notable achievements:

  • Multiple Grammy Award nominations
  • Several chart-topping singles, including "Super Bass" and "Starships"
  • Collaboration with renowned artists such as Drake, Lil Wayne, and Beyoncé

Empowerment Through Sexuality

Minaj’s music often serves as a platform for discussing female empowerment. Songs like "Anaconda" and "Pills N Potions" highlight her confidence and control over her sexuality, challenging traditional gender norms.
